Following his award-winning Mansfeld trilogy, Mario Schneider returns to Leipzig with a film that is simply astonishing. The basic idea is captivating: on one level, the film tells the story of three people who pose nude at the local art academy. This creates a point of intersection from which the film credibly enters and exits the world of its protagonists. At the same time, it connects the work of art with that of life, while the moment of posing nude invites viewers to contemplate the human body.
